BOULDER - For the sixth straight summer, the University of Colorado is hosting the Intercollegiate Tennis Association (ITA) Summer Circuit, July 6-8 (Saturday-Monday) at the South Campus Tennis Courts.

The first day singles and doubles of the men and women results are included.

CU's Dhany Quevedo and Winde Janssens teamed up in the women's doubles draw and reached Sunday's final with an 8-1 win over Callie Morlock/Shelby Cerkovnik.

In singles, Quevedo advanced to Sunday's semifinal after a three-set winner over Linley Busby of Villanova, 6-7(7), 6-3, 6-4.

Boulder is the first of three stops in the Mountain Region during July with United States Air Force Academy (July 20-22) and University of New Mexico (July 27-29) hosting similar events
